A vivid and fast-moving portrait of the United States Air Force, which went from the ruins of World War II demobilization to become the principal weapon of the world's only Superpower, rendered through archival film

    Over the objections of the Navy, the USAF is created out of the remnants of the WWII Army Air Forces. American military leaders came back from World War II convinced of the importance of air power and the need for expansion in the future. On September 18th, 1947 the Air Force was split off from the Army and a new branch of the military was born. Within a year, the new service conducts the Berlin Airlift in its first Cold War test.
